You never know exactly how something\u2019s going to turn out once you start editing, and it\u2019s better to have too much footage \u2014 too many options \u2014&nbsp;than not enough. Stay flexible and innovative too. When filming, try new shots, experiment with angles, and be willing to shift gears depending on the situation.
